The Bay at Your Own Pace
A private Bay of Islands tour dedicates a guide and vehicle (or boat) exclusively to your group — the islands, the cultural sites, the water activities, and the pace are shaped around your interests. The Bay of Islands’ geography (144 islands scattered across a subtropical bay, with the historic towns of Paihia, Russell, and Kerikeri on its shores) means a private guide can combine the water-based experiences (island cruising, dolphin watching, snorkelling) with the land-based attractions (the Waitangi Treaty Grounds, the kauri forests, the food and wine stops) in a single, flexible day.
Private tours are particularly valuable for combining the Hole in the Rock cruise with a Waitangi Treaty Grounds visit and a vineyard lunch — a triple combination that standard group tours do not offer in a single day.

How much does a private Bay of Islands tour cost?
Private guided day tours typically cost NZD 500–1,200+ depending on the activities, the vehicle/boat, and the group size. The cost is per tour, not per person.
Can a private tour combine boat and land activities?
Yes — the Bay’s compact geography allows a morning cruise (Hole in the Rock, dolphin watching) combined with an afternoon on land (Waitangi, kauri forest, food and wine). The guide manages the logistics.
